Description

Wood is recruiting for a Supply Chain Lead / Procurement Coordinator to join its Projects – Process and Chemical team for execution on supply chain activities of complex plants in the Chemical, Petrochemical and Energy industries. The position will be based in Corsico (Milan) office, with the possibility to work from home up to two days per week.

#LI-Hybrid

The Role

You will assist the Project Supply Chain Manager in all aspect of the purchasing cycle of our projects.
